Video lens and electronic device

ActiveCN115755340BReduce distortion ratereduce volumeLow distortionOphthalmology
This invention discloses a video lens and an electronic device. The video lens has an object side and an image side arranged opposite to each other along the optical axis. The video lens includes a lens barrel and a lens group disposed within the lens barrel. The lens group includes a first lens, a second lens, a third lens, a fourth lens, a fifth lens, a sixth lens, and a photosensitive chip arranged sequentially from the object side to the image side. The video lens satisfies the following condition: 0.1≤FA / TTL≤0.25, where FA is the optical focal length of the video lens, and TTL is the distance between the object side surface of the first lens and the imaging surface of the video lens on the optical axis. Through the reasonable arrangement of the five lenses, the optical focal length FA and the total optical length TTL of the optical system of the video lens satisfy the relationship: 0.1≤FA / TTL≤0.25, and the distortion rate reaches below 3%, so as to provide a video lens with small size, low distortion rate, and 4K high pixel resolution.

A grating galvanometer device and a control system and method thereof

PendingCN122512830AHigh precisionAngular positioning error reduction
This invention discloses a grating galvanometer device and its control system and method. The grating galvanometer device includes: a grating galvanometer motor with a motor output shaft; a galvanometer clamp mounted on the end of the motor output shaft for clamping and fixing a laser reflector; a triangular chuck-type quick clamp with one end coaxially fixedly connected to the motor output shaft; a DD motor with a motor output shaft, the other end of which is rigidly connected to the quick clamp to allow the motor output shaft to rotate coaxially with the galvanometer; and a motor bracket for supporting the grating galvanometer motor and the DD motor. This invention uses real-time feedback data from the DD motor as a precision benchmark, enabling the acquisition, modeling, and iterative correction of short-cycle errors during the operation of the galvanometer motor. This solves the short-cycle error problem existing in low-resolution grating galvanometer motors, achieves real-time correction of the galvanometer motor's angle positioning error, improves the accuracy and consistency of laser processing, reduces equipment hardware costs, and enhances adaptability to various working conditions.

A method for analyzing stability of a multi-machine parallel system of energy storage converters

A kind of energy storage converter multi-machine parallel system stability analysis method, comprising: modeling and control of single PCS;Application of capacitor current feedback type active damping control strategy;Analysis of stability of single PCS under PI control;Mathematical modeling of multiple PCS parallel system;Establishment of parallel system norton equivalent circuit;Using logarithmic frequency characteristic curve, verify that active damping control can have better inhibitory effect on resonance peak of parallel system.Capacitor current feedback type active damping method can not only compensate resonance peak of parallel system, improve the stability of system, but also effectively reduce grid-connected current distortion rate, improve power quality.The stability analysis method for PCS multi-machine parallel system provided by the present application can be used for judging the operating state of parallel system, ensure the stable operation of system, and provide theoretical basis for parameter design of PCS controller.

High-magnetic-gathering reactance saturation less-rare-earth permanent magnet and electromagnetic salient pole hybrid excitation motor

The invention relates to the technical field of motors, in particular to a high-magnetism-gathering anti-saturation less rare earth permanent magnet and electromagnetic salient pole hybrid excitation motor which comprises a front end cover, a machine shell, a rear end cover, a rotating shaft, a stator and a rotor. The rotor is composed of a rotor iron core, neodymium iron boron permanent magnet steel, ferrite permanent magnet steel and an excitation winding, an even number of salient poles are uniformly distributed on the rotor iron core, arc-shaped contours are processed on two sides of a pole body of each salient pole to form a gourd-like excitation winding groove, the excitation winding is wound in the gourd-like excitation winding groove, and the excitation winding is wound in the excitation winding groove. Magnetic steel grooves for placing ferrite permanent magnet steel are formed in the outer sides of the gourd-like excitation winding grooves; and magnetic steel grooves for placing neodymium iron boron permanent magnet steel and arc-shaped magnetic isolation grooves are formed in the salient pole shoes. According to the invention, the magnetism gathering performance of the salient pole rotor can be effectively improved, the air gap flux density waveform can be improved, the distortion rate can be reduced, and the design of the gourd-like excitation winding grooves can effectively reduce the magnetic circuit saturation of the rotor and improve the torque performance of the motor.
